How Apple Developer Account Subscription Works
The Apple Developer Program costs $99/year (USD). The subscription auto-renews annually by default if payment is set up through Apple. When you purchase an account from us, auto-renewal is typically not configured — so manual renewal is required each year.
The subscription period starts from the date the account was created, not the calendar year. So if the account was created in March, it expires in March the following year.
